Located in Lakeland, Florida, just Northeast of Tampa and a bit Southwest of Orlanda is where you'll find us enjoying life at Assisi Clumber Spaniels.
I have been involved in Clumber Spaniels for 12 years, getting my first Clumber in 1995. My foundation stock came to me from Ronnie Watt's Nonsuch Kennel in South Africa, from Hilda and Paul Monaghan's Tweedsmuir Kennel in England, and from Helen Marshall and Otto Wahl's Shogun Kennel in Dousman, Wisconsin. I am an active member in The Clumber Spaniel Club of America and currently serve the membership as the Club's Secretary, the Clumber Spaniel Fanciers of Michigan, and the Williana Clumber Spaniel Club. Ch. Leybel Vagabond, our Beloved Bond who was bred by the late Maybel Hall in England, was Bill's hunting buddy and the two were featured in the Animal Planet program, Breed All About It.
